Magnitude 4.3 Earthquake Strikes Off Coast of Driouch, Morocco

The province of Driouch recorded a new seismic shock of magnitude 4.3 on the Richter scale this Saturday, according to an announcement by the National Institute of Geophysics (ING).

The epicenter of the shock is located off the coast of the province of Driouch, according to the National Institute of Geophysics (ING). This earthquake occurred at 05:19:15 (GMT+1), according to the National Seismic Monitoring and Alert Network of the ING in a seismic alert bulletin.

The felt shock has a depth of 18 km, a latitude of 35.478°N and a longitude of 3.566°W, adds the same source.
